RedHawks Shutout Ball State 3-0
9/27/2024 5:06:00 PM | Field Hockey
MUNCIE, IND. – The Miami University field hockey team shutout the Ball State University Cardinals 3-0 on Friday evening. This pushes the RedHawks' record to 5-4 on the season (2-1 Mid-American Conference). Ball State drops to 1-6 (0-2 MAC).

HOW IT HAPPENED:
- With two minutes remaining in the first quarter, Claudia Negrete Garcia scored during a penalty corner off assists from Carlie Servis and Berta Mata to put the RedHawks ahead 1-0.
- The RedHawks held their 1-0 lead through the end of the quarter.
- Three minutes into the second quarter, Negrete Garcia scored again, this time unassisted, to double the lead 2-0.
- The Red and White held this 2-0 lead through the end of the half and through the third quarter.
- With ten minutes remaining in the game, Reese Wearren scored to make it a 3-0 Miami lead.
- The RedHawks took the game in a shutout 3-0.
